I bought this Lexus NX300H from Japan
This is accident car, i bought it all the spare parts from Japan and now it has been fixed but the vehicle didn't start.
We have tried all programming machine to decode the module but the machine is asking for VIN number
The VIN number is for America manufacturer which is 17 number but in Japan is call Chassis Number which is 12 number
i need someone to help me to work on this Chassis number for me to get VIN for this vehicle.

The last seven digits represent the serial number of the car. I don’t believe there is a “translation” but you may be able to create a VIN for the software based upon the information and Chassis number you already have.
